How much money will you need for your trip to Washington? You should plan to spend around $155 per day on your vacation in Washington, which is the average daily price based on the of other visitors. Past travelers have spent, on average, $30 on meals for one day and $37 on local transportation.

Is DC cheaper than NYC?

It scores Manhattan as 117% more expensive than most cities (more than double) and Brooklyn 67% more expensive. D.C. is only 38% more expensive, according to their rankings. To be sure, D.C. is not cheap . But there's almost no measure by which it makes sense to consider it more expensive than New York City.

What is the best month to visit DC?

The best times to visit Washington, D.C., are from September to November and March to May . In the autumn, the sweltering summer is gone, taking with it most of the high season tourists. All that's left are crisp breezes and changing leaves, which, by the way, look great against all those marble monuments.

Does DC have snow?

Snow does occur this month but measurable snowfalls, on average, occur on only 1 or 2 days with snowfalls of 1 inch (2.5cm) or more occurring on one day every year or two and snows of 3 inches (7.6 CM) or more falling only about once every 5 years.

How hot is DC in June?

June Weather in Washington, D.C. Washington, D.C.; United States. Daily high temperatures increase by 7°F, from 80°F to 86°F , rarely falling below 70°F or exceeding 94°F. Daily low temperatures increase by 7°F, from 63°F to 70°F, rarely falling below 54°F or exceeding 75°F.

Is DC expensive?

Numbeo's cost of living index, which factors the cost of consumer goods prices, including groceries, restaurants, transportation, and utilities, scores Washington D.C. at 83.68 out of 100 —meaning that it's about 16% less expensive than New York City, the index's benchmark city (with a score of 100).

Is it easy to drive in DC?

Even if you have experience driving in cities, driving in D.C. can be hard at certain times of the day . It's an easy city to navigate, but the traffic can be bad on weekends or around rush hour. If you have the option to leave your car outside the city, however, D.C. has an excellent public transportation system.

What foods is DC known for?

D.C.'s Iconic Foods And Where To Find Them. Some of the contenders for the title of D.C.'s most iconic food: Jumbo slice by Pizza Boli's, a half-smoke from Ben's Chili Bowl, and pupusas from El Tamarindo. You can tell you're in Washington, D.C., just by looking at it.

Is DC crowded in May?

May and October usually offer beautiful weather, but can be crowded (particularly May) . Can't stand crowds but don't mind the cold? Visit in January or February where your reward for braving the wet weather is empty museums and cheap hotel rooms.
